Product Introduction

Overview

The TMS320VC5510A, specifically the TMS320VC5510AZGWD2, is a high-performance, low-power fixed-point digital signal processor (DSP) from Texas Instruments. It is based on the TMS320C55x DSP generation CPU processor core, which is designed to achieve high performance and low power consumption through increased parallelism and a focus on reducing power dissipation.

This DSP is part of the C55x family, known for its robust architecture that includes multiple buses, allowing for up to three data reads and two data writes in a single cycle. The device is supported by a comprehensive software environment, including the eXpressDSP software, Code Composer Studio, DSP/BIOS, and the TMS320 DSP Algorithm Standard, along with extensive third-party support.

Key Specifications

Specification Details
Instruction Cycle Time 6.25-/5-ns
Clock Rate 160-/200-MHz
Instructions per Cycle One/Two Instructions
Multiply-Accumulate Units Dual Multipliers (Up to 400 MMACS)
Arithmetic/Logic Units Two ALUs
Internal Buses One Internal Program Bus, Three Internal Data/Operand Read Buses, Two Internal Data/Operand Write Buses
Instruction Cache 24K Bytes
On-Chip RAM 160K x 16-Bit (64K Bytes DARAM, 256K Bytes SARAM)
On-Chip ROM 16K x 16-Bit (32K Bytes)
External Memory Interface 32-Bit EMIF with glueless interface to SRAM, EPROM, SDRAM, SBSRAM
Peripherals Two 20-Bit Timers, Six-Channel DMA Controller, Three McBSPs, 16-Bit EHPI, DPLL Clock Generator
GPIO Pins
Package 240-Terminal MicroStar BGA (Ball Grid Array)
Supply Voltage 3.3-V I/O Supply Voltage, 1.6-V Core Supply Voltage

Key Features

  • High-performance, low-power fixed-point DSP based on the TMS320C55x DSP generation CPU processor core.
  • High-speed instruction execution with up to two instructions per cycle.
  • Dual multiply-accumulate units capable of up to 400 million multiply-accumulates per second (MMACS).
  • Two arithmetic/logic units (ALUs) and a central 40-bit ALU supported by an additional 16-bit ALU.
  • Instruction cache of 24K bytes and extensive on-chip RAM and ROM.
  • 32-bit external memory interface with glueless interface to various memory types.
  • On-chip peripherals including two 20-bit timers, six-channel DMA controller, three multichannel buffered serial ports (McBSPs), and a 16-bit parallel enhanced host-port interface (EHPI).
  • Programmable digital phase-locked loop (DPLL) clock generator and IEEE Std 1149.1 (JTAG) boundary scan logic.
  • Eight general-purpose I/O (GPIO) pins and dedicated general-purpose output (XF).
  • Low-power control of six device functional domains.

Applications

The TMS320VC5510A is versatile and can be used in a variety of applications, including:

  • Portable digital video applications, such as video codecs, color space conversion, and user-interface operations.
  • Audio processing, including voice recognition and text-to-speech conversion.
  • Medical imaging and diagnostics.
  • Machine vision and industrial automation.
  • Security and surveillance systems.
  • TCP/IP and network communication devices.
